The news from the annual Rector's Cup Soccer Tournament at which Saint Charles Borromeo Seminary (Overbrook), Mount Saint Mary's, Immaculate Conception (Seton Hall) and Saint Joseph's (Dunwoodie) competed, took place on September 26-27, 2009. The scores:

Saturday:

Mt St Mary's  2 - St Charles Borromeo 1

Immaculate Conception 3 - St Joseph's 2 (OT)


Sunday:

St Charles Borromeo 2 - St Joseph's 0

Mt St Mary's 4 - Immaculate Conception 2


The 2010 tournament will be at Immaculate Conception and in 2011 it will be at St Joseph's. For more info, see the Rector's blog.
